Two poems

These are short poems I wrote while on the tsunami relief trip. They aren't really masterpieces, but perhaps they will touch you anyways.

Beauty from Ashes

Pain too deep for words
Loss I can’t comprehend
A world that has been shattered
A beauty forever lost
A “why?’ that can never be answered
And yet as I look at the devastation
I marvel at all that remains
The broken pieces hurt
In a world gone up in flames
But as the ashes scatter to the wind
I watch them as they fly away
And I see in the sky a beauty waiting to be born
The sweetest joy comes from bitterest pain
Songs of praise can come from weeping
And You will give joy again

Faces of the Children

In a world made desolate
The faces of the children reveal the future
Their smiles are filled
With the promise of laughter
Their eyes sparkle
With the promise of hope
Behind their chatter
One hears the promise of song
They still view the world with wonder
Though they have seen more of its pain than most
As they run and play
A promise of life is born
They have lost family, lost love, lost joy
But the spirit of the child lives on
Promising a people with a trust in all things good
Faith, hope, and love
Joy, innocence, and trust
The child’s heart holds all
For in a world made desolate
The faces of the children reveal the future
